OK here's my problem. I have 1 cell with something like this: XXXXX
YYYYY. It's alphanumeric (has some numbers and a letter). I need to
format this to look like XXXXXXX in 1 cell, and then YYYYYY in the cell
to the right of that. I need to do this for thousands of cells in
thousands of rows..... Please tell me there's an easier way to do this
than going into each cell and copy then paste into the cell next to it.
Thanks!--

If that's a space between your Xs and your Ys, then Data/ Text to columns/
Delimited/ Space
